HALF-TIME: Jamaica's Reggae Boyz lead Nicaragua 1-0

Published:Tuesday | September 8, 2015 | 12:00 AM

Jamaica's Reggae Boyz are leading Nicaragua 1-0 at half-time in their second leg of the FIFA World Cup qualifier in Managua, Nicaragua.

Striker Darren Mattocks netted Jamaica's lone goal of the match so far.

The Reggae Boyz who were beaten 3-2 at home last Friday, must win tonight's game by at least two clear goals to advance to the next phase of the competition.

The Boyz are playing this without their midfielder captain  Rudolph Austin and striker Giles Barnes.

Austin is currently is Mexico sorting out his work permit for his new club in Denmark, while Barnes has returned to his Major League Soccer club in the United States.
